Let's take a look at the effects of boiling loquat leaves in water? I hope everyone can understand.

1. Vomiting due to stomach heat. Take 15g of loquat leaves, 20g of bamboo shavings, 10g of Ophiopogon japonicus, and 6g of processed Pinellia ternata, decocted in water and taken, 1 dose per day.

2. Hoarse voice. Take 30g of fresh loquat leaves (remove the hair) and 15g of light bamboo leaves, decoct in water and take one dose per day. Generally, the effect will be seen after 2-3 doses.

3. Nosebleed. Take an appropriate amount of loquat leaves, remove the hair, dry them, grind them into powder and sieve them for later use. Take 6g each time, with tea, 2-3 times a day. Generally, the effect will gradually appear after taking it several times.

4. Weaning. Take 11-17 fresh old loquat leaves or 60g of dried leaves, remove the hair, wash and chop, add 700ml of water, simmer until the volume reaches 350-400ml, take it in 3 times within 1 day, 1 dose per day. Generally, 2-6 doses are required to completely stop lactation.

5. Plum pit qi. The so-called plum pit qi refers to the feeling of a plum pit-like obstruction in the throat, which cannot be spit out or swallowed, but there are no symptoms of dysphagia. It is the name of a disease in traditional Chinese medicine, and belongs to neurosis and chronic pharyngitis in modern medicine. For this disease, 30g of loquat leaves can be used, the fluff is brushed off, the leaves are washed with water, shredded and dried; add 200ml of water for the first time, boil until 100ml, and filter the juice; add 160ml of water again, boil until 100ml, and filter the juice; mix the two juices and take them warm twice a day, morning and evening.
